from wikipedia:

On October 17, Megi became the first tropical cyclone to have a pressure below 900 millibars since Hurricane Wilma in 2005.[103] Later that day, it became the first tropical cyclone since Hurricane Allen in 1980 to have one-minute sustained winds of 190 mph. Early on October 18, the JMA reported that 10-minute sustained winds had increased to 230 km/h (145 mph), making Megi one of three storms to attain this intensity, after Super Typhoon Bess (1982) and Super Typhoon Tip (1979). When it made landfall on October 18, it became one of the strongest tropical cyclones recorded to make landfall. Megi was the strongest typhoon to hit the Philippines in four years.[104]

Just to pass the time, I thought I would pass on some info-- right now the Atlantic is still at record warm levels:

Atlantic SSTs

The general -NAO/AO combination has been very effective at keeping this warm water in place, due to all the relaxed

trades because of the weak Atlantic ridge. This would generally would herald an active 2011. Yet, there is some trouble

ahead. All models have been consistently showing a positive, in fact very positive NAO/AO developing:

AO forecasts

This would take a big chunk out of those warm SSTs and reduce them below record levels for February. It all depends on

how long the trades last, but it seems like a fair bet is at least two weeks of 20-25 kt, maybe higher, trades over a large portion

of the Atlantic basin.

La Nina remains at moderate/strong levels, but should weaken during the late winter/spring. I'm not sure it matters much over

the long haul, but a safe bet at this time is weak La Nina or neutral conditions. We would need some significant westerly wind

bursts over the western and central Pacific to even get me worried about El Nino this year, and climo is heavily against that.

Is there any relation to the pattern that has brought NYC 60 inches of snow this winter and the ensuing tropical season?

Weakly, yes. The early season -NAO did not allow systems to dig into the subtropics, keeping cold air masses away from the Tropical Atlantic. That has helped keep SSTs elevated across the Tropical Atlantic. There is no relationship, to my knowledge, between winter patterns and future warm season cyclone tracks.

CPC:

Nearly all of the ENSO model forecasts weaken La Niña in the coming months (Fig. 6). A majority of the models predict a return to ENSO-neutral conditions by May-June-July 2011, although some models persist a weaker La Niña into the Northern Hemisphere summer 2011. Recent trends in the observations and models do not offer many hints on which outcome is more likely. Also, model skill is historically at a minimum during the Northern Hemisphere spring (the “spring barrier”). Therefore La Niña is expected to weaken during the next several months, with ENSO-neutral or La Niña conditions equally likely during May-June 2011.
